在数字化时代,编程不仅是一门技术,更是一种思维方式。对于台州的孩子来说,学习编程不仅能让他们掌握一项实用技能,更能培养他们的逻辑思维与创造力。那么,如何从零基础开始,让孩子一步步成长为编程小达人呢?本文将为您揭秘培养孩子编程能力的秘诀。
一、了解少儿编程的重要性
1.1 培养逻辑思维能力
编程本质上是一种逻辑思维活动。通过学习编程,孩子们可以学会如何分析问题、分解问题,并找到解决问题的方法。这种逻辑思维能力在孩子的学习和生活中都具有重要的意义。
1.2 提高创造力
编程过程中,孩子们需要不断尝试、创新,从而培养出丰富的想象力。在解决编程问题的过程中,他们可以发挥自己的创造力,设计出独特的程序。
1.3 增强团队合作能力
在团队合作项目中,孩子们需要学会与他人沟通、协作,共同完成任务。这有助于提高他们的团队协作能力。
二、台州少儿编程课程体系
2.1 初级阶段
在这一阶段,孩子们主要学习Scratch、Python等图形化编程语言。通过这些编程语言,孩子们可以轻松地实现自己的想法,并逐渐掌握编程的基本概念。
2.2 中级阶段
在中级阶段,孩子们开始接触更复杂的编程语言,如C++、Java等。他们需要学会编写代码,实现更复杂的程序。
2.3 高级阶段
在高级阶段,孩子们可以参加各类编程竞赛,提升自己的编程水平。同时,他们还可以学习算法、数据结构等专业知识,为未来职业生涯打下坚实基础。
三、如何培养孩子的编程能力
3.1 选择合适的编程课程
根据孩子的兴趣和年龄,选择适合他们的编程课程。例如,对图形化编程感兴趣的孩子可以选择Scratch;对算法感兴趣的孩子可以选择Python。
3.2 注重实践
编程是一门实践性很强的学科。家长和老师应鼓励孩子们多动手实践,通过实际操作来巩固所学知识。
3.3 鼓励创新
在编程过程中,鼓励孩子们发挥自己的创造力,尝试不同的解决方案。即使失败,也要让他们学会总结经验,不断改进。
3.4 培养良好的学习习惯
良好的学习习惯是提高编程能力的关键。家长和老师应引导孩子们养成按时完成作业、认真阅读教材、主动请教问题的习惯。
四、台州少儿编程的未来发展
随着科技的不断发展,编程将成为孩子们必备的技能之一。在台州,少儿编程教育将迎来更加广阔的发展空间。以下是台州少儿编程的未来发展方向:
4.1 深化课程体系改革
不断完善课程体系,将编程教育融入到更多学科领域,满足不同年龄段孩子的学习需求。
4.2 加强师资队伍建设
培养一批具有专业素养的编程教师,为孩子们提供优质的编程教育。
4.3 拓展合作领域
与高校、企业等机构合作,为孩子们提供更多实践机会,助力他们成长为编程人才。
总之,台州少儿编程教育在培养孩子的逻辑思维与创造力方面具有重要意义。通过选择合适的课程、注重实践、鼓励创新和培养良好的学习习惯,孩子们将能够从零基础成长为编程小达人。让我们一起期待台州少儿编程教育的美好未来!
